Choose the right study path before you spend hours on the wrong question bank.
Start here if you need to handle regulated refrigerants. EPA 608 is the baseline credential for Core, Type I, Type II, Type III, and Universal certification prep.
Use NATE Core when you want professional certification prep across safety, tools, electrical basics, heat transfer, and applied HVAC knowledge.
If you are not sure where you stand, start with mixed sample questions and use your weak areas to pick the next exam-specific study guide.
| Exam Path | Best First User | Main Topics | Next Step |
|---|---|---|---|
| EPA 608 | Anyone handling refrigerants | Core, appliance types, recovery, evacuation, leak repair | Study EPA 608 |
| NATE Core | Techs preparing for professional NATE certification | Safety, tools, electrical basics, heat transfer, measurements | Practice NATE Core |
| NATE Specialty | Techs focused on a field path | AC service, heat pumps, gas heating, troubleshooting | Choose a specialty |
